Israel pays dearly for botched raid on Gaza
Rights and Accountability 13 November 2018
At least 10 Palestinian fighters have been killed since a busted commando operation in Gaza broke a ceasefire between Israel and resistance factions on Sunday night.
An Israeli military officer was killed and another moderately wounded in Sunday’s botched operation that left a Hamas military commander and six other fighters dead:
Palestinian groups fired hundreds of rockets towards Israel Monday night – described by Israeli media as the largest ever projectile barrage from Gaza.
The Qassam Brigades, the armed wing of Hamas, stated that resistance fighters targeted a bus transporting soldiers east of Gaza with a Kornet anti-tank guided missile. A 19-year-old soldier was severely injured, according to reports.
The group said that the strike was in response to the killing of seven fighters on Sunday.
